Section 1: The Rise of Deep Learning in Time Series Analysis
Recent advancements in deep learning have significantly impacted the field of time series analysis. Techniques such as Recurrent Neural Networks (RNNs), Long Short-Term Memory (LSTM) networks, and Temporal Convolutional Networks (TCNs) have proven effective in modeling complex temporal relationships. The Certificate in Python for Data Science: Time Series Analysis and Forecasting covers these cutting-edge methods, empowering learners to leverage deep learning for improved forecasting accuracy. For instance, LSTM networks can learn long-term dependencies in time series data, enabling more accurate predictions in applications like financial forecasting and weather forecasting.

Section 3: The Growing Importance of Explainability and Interpretability
As time series analysis becomes more prevalent in decision-making processes, the need for explainability and interpretability has grown. The Certificate in Python for Data Science: Time Series Analysis and Forecasting emphasizes the importance of model interpretability, teaching learners how to use techniques like SHAP values and LIME to explain complex model predictions. This focus on transparency enables data scientists to build trust in their models and communicate insights more effectively to stakeholders. For instance, in healthcare, interpretable time series models can help clinicians understand patient outcomes and make more informed treatment decisions.
